Irwell Road - Temporary Road Closure
What is happening?
The Council of the City of Salford intends to make in no less than 7 days the Salford City Council ( Irwell Road, Salford) (Temporary Road Closure) Order 2024 under Section 14 of the Road Traffic Regulation Act 1984. The Order will close the northbound carriageway on Irwell Street, allowing northbound traffic to use the southbound lane. Southbound traffic will be diverted along Trinity Way. The closure is required as AE Yates Ltd are carrying major alterations as part of the Irwell Street Scheme. The scheme includes the construction of cycle lanes which will be reducing Irwell Street to a single lane northbound providing enhanced public realm features around the EDEN Development. The Order is due to come into operation on the 12 February 2024 and will last for a period of 10 weeks.

Diversions
Trinity Way Southbound Traffic:
Trinity Way - A57 Dawson Street - Egerton Street - A56 Chester Road - Bridgewater Viaduct - Deansgate - Quay Street.
Traffic on Trinity Way wanting to turn right onto Irwell Street:
Northbound on Trinity Way - Right onto A6 Chapel Street - Right onto A34 New Bailey Street - A34 Bridge Street - Right onto Deansgate.
